Synopsis

For many years, your spaceship travelled silently through galaxies far from Earth, controlled only by a large computer. You, along with your fellow crew members, have remained in a state of suspended animation, your vital life functions being constantly monitored by the computer. Two hours ago, the computer started to awaken you from your slumber to help assess the damage caused by a meteor striking the ship. Your only course of action was to land on the nearest planet to arrange for repairs.

Unaware of the atmospheric storms of ‘Lucia’, you attempted to land the ship on a small platform high above the planet’s surface. Unfortunately, the violent winds drove the ship off the edge of the platform. When you came round after the crash, you found that the computer had been damaged beyond repair and the life support functions had failed. You are alone and need to repair the ship so that you can return to Earth. Your task will not be easy!

Notes

Appeared as a type-in in both MSX Adventure Programming and Adventure Programming on the Amstrad CPC 464 & 664, published by Argus Books in 1985.
